An allergist is the most qualified medical professional that can diagnose your condition. Because multivitamins contain multiple vitamins, the allergist will perform allergy tests to determine which vitamin or ingredient is causing the allergic reaction. Recent Findings Vitamins A, C, D, and E seem to be extremely safe compounds, with few or no related case of anaphylaxis to them. Vitamin B1 is considered the most allergenic vitamin. While this particular vitamin C serum didn't actually burn or sting on contact with my skin, just...Jun 27, 2018 · Very good tolerability was reported in 70 of 71 patients (98.6%). In 1 of the 71 patients (1.4%), 2 adverse reactions to vitamin C infusion were recorded, but treatment was continued. These adverse reactions were “repeated unpleasant sensation of cold a few hours after infusion” and “tiredness the next morning.” May 4, 2023 · Vitamin C is touted for its many health benefits: It boosts immunity, improves heart health, bolsters iron absorption, and much more. But when it is not used correctly, it can worsen sagging ...Vitamin C plays many roles in the chemistry of the human body. It’s needed to make collagen. This is a critical part of the body's connective tissue. It also helps increase the absorption of iron from the intestines. This is needed to make hemoglobin, the oxygen-carrying pigment inside of red blood cells.

One of the biggest drivers of this skin irritation in vitamin C-containing products is its pH level. “Normal skin pH is around 5.5, but some vitamin C formulations require a low pH, around 3.5, for stability and efficacy,” Dr. de Golian explains. “In patients with sensitive skin, seeking ...
